On Tue, Jun 15, 2010 at 02:38:05PM +0100, George Dunlap wrote: > The following thread has a discussion of setting up a serial console > for debugging, if you need it: > > http://www.mailinglistarchive.com/html/xen-devel@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x/2009-05/msg00004.html > And some info here: http://wiki.xensource.com/xenwiki/XenSerialConsole -- Pasi > -George > > On Tue, Jun 15, 2010 at 2:25 PM, Keir Fraser <keir.fraser@xxxxxxxxxxxxx> > wrote: > > Connect a serial line and collect the hypervisor's debug console output. > > You'll probably get a crash dump when the machine reboots itself. > > > > -- Keir > > > > On 15/06/2010 14:13, "Kathy Hadley" <Kathy.Hadley@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> wrote: > > > >> Greetings, > >> I am trying to debug a Xen crash and need some help. When I am > >> attempting > >> to use the (relatively) new adjust_global scheduler callback function, the > >> machine reboots (this may be due to other changes I have made in the > >> hypervisor to modify DornerWorks¹ ARINC 653 scheduler to work with CPU > >> pools). > >> I have enabled xend/xenstored tracing, but the log files do not contain > >> anything useful. I have used gdb to trace to the point where the > >> hypercall is > >> made from Dom0 to the hypervisor, but do not know how to proceed from > >> here. I > >> have read about using kdb to debug the hypervisor, but I am a bit confused. > >> It looks as though kdb (in http://xenbits.xensource.com/ext/debuggers.hg) > >> is > >> integrated into a particular branch of Xen, which is not kept synchronized > >> with the current version of xen-unstable. Can I use kdb with any version > >> of > >> Xen? If so, how? What files do I need to download and what should I do to > >> build them?
